腾讯云
开发者社区
文档
建议反馈
控制台
首页
学习
活动
专区
工具
TVP
最新优惠活动
文章/答案/技术大牛
搜索
搜索
关闭
发布
登录/注册
精选内容/技术社群/优惠产品,
尽在小程序
立即前往
文章
问答
(9999+)
视频
沙龙
2
回答
在
react
with
hooks
中
,
我
如何
复制
和
数组
,
然后
反转
它
?
reactjs
、
create-react-app
、
react-bootstrap
我
有两个
数组
: function App() { const [reversedHistoryText所以我想我应该首先将
数组
复制
到一个临时
数组
中
:
我
尝试这样做: setReversedHistoryText([...reversedHistoryText, historyText]);
和
setReversedHistoryText(hi
浏览 22
提问于2019-12-27
得票数 0
回答已采纳
6
回答
没有找到规则“
react
钩子/详尽-deps”的定义。
javascript
、
reactjs
、
react-hooks
、
eslint
、
standardjs
在
我
的代码
中
添加// eslint-disable-next-line
react
-
hooks
/exhaustive-deps后,
我
将得到下面的eslint错误。8:14没有找到规则“
react
钩子/详尽-deps”的错误定义。
我
参考了 post来解决这个问题,但是上面提到的解决方案
在
我
的情况下不起作用。有什么线索可以阻止这个错误吗?PS --
我
用的是
浏览 9
提问于2020-01-06
得票数 51
回答已采纳
4
回答
React
\
React
缺少一个依赖项
reactjs
、
react-hooks
我
想更新一个值,
在
商店
中
只有一次
在
第一次打开时,当页面是第一次打开使用反应钩子。为此,
我
将useEffect '[]‘的第二个参数设为空列表。没有什么能阻止
它
工作,但是
我
从ESLint规则
中
得到了一个警告:
React
useEffect缺少一个依赖项:'changeCount‘。要么包含
它
,要么删除依赖
数组
Resive-挂钩/详尽-deps。
如何
删除此
浏览 6
提问于2021-02-13
得票数 4
回答已采纳
6
回答
在
HoC中使用时警告
reactjs
、
eslint
、
react-hooks
我
已经创建了一个高阶组件,
它
应该为
我
的组件添加一些额外的功能。然而,当我在这个组件中使用
react
时,我会得到下面的eslint警告。
React
"
React
.useEffect“不能在回调
中
调用。必须在
React
函
数组
件或自定义
React
函数
中
调用。(反应钩/钩规则)
我
为什么要收到这个警告?
在
HoC中使用钩子被认为是不好的做法吗?最起
浏览 7
提问于2019-05-24
得票数 20
回答已采纳
1
回答
在
使用状态钩子时,useState()
在
function
中
如何
检索功能组件的正确状态对象
和
函数?
javascript
、
reactjs
、
react-hooks
我
目前正致力于从
react
角度理解useState钩子。
我
想知道的是,当调用useState时,
它
如何
能够正确地检索状态对象
和
可用于修改
它
的函数(假设它在第一次调用时已经创建)。另一种表达
我
的问题的方法是,计数
和
setCount在哪里存在?useState()显然将返回一个不同的状态对象
和
修饰符函数,这取决于调用哪个功能组件useState,那么这是
如何
工作的?
我
的猜测是形成一个
浏览 0
提问于2019-02-25
得票数 3
回答已采纳
1
回答
启用eslint反应钩关闭所有的eslint规则。
eslint
、
eslint-config-airbnb
、
eslintrc
我
试图获得
react
-
hooks
规则,但它似乎不适用于我的设置(VSCode,CRA,airbnb,tslint,更漂亮)。"~3.8.3"
然后
我
尝试将以下内容添加到extends
中
的.eslintrc
中
"extends": ["plugin:
react
/recommended", "plugin:
react
-
hooks
浏览 0
提问于2020-04-29
得票数 0
回答已采纳
1
回答
使用axios从rest
中
获取数据,并使用useEffect重新生成空
数组
和数据
数组
。
reactjs
、
react-hooks
、
use-effect
我
试图从rest站点呈现数据,
我
可以毫无问题地获取所有信息,但首先使用空
数组
复制
数据,这将与map()函数产生冲突。 import { useEf
浏览 5
提问于2022-06-08
得票数 0
回答已采纳
4
回答
在
react
js
中
更改
数组
后
如何
映射
数组
?
javascript
、
arrays
、
reactjs
我
正在映射一个
数组
,每个
数组
都有一个从
数组
中
删除
它
的按钮: const comments = [ 'Hey', 'Yo' ]; </button> } 单击该按钮时,该项目将被删除,并且
浏览 35
提问于2020-07-21
得票数 0
回答已采纳
1
回答
对于“详尽-deps”的警告一直要求完整的“props”对象,而不是允许单个“props”方法作为依赖项。
javascript
、
reactjs
、
react-hooks
、
eslint-plugin-react-hooks
当我
在
CodeSanbox中使用
React
时,
我
可以使用props对象的单个属性作为useEffect钩子的依赖项:useEffect(()=>{ 如果
我
将[props.myProp]添加到
数组
中
,警告就会消失。但是,
在
VSCode的本地环境
中
,同样的示例1,
我
浏览 2
提问于2019-07-31
得票数 2
4
回答
当有条件地使用
react
钩子时,为什么eslint-plugin-
react
-
hooks
没有警告?
reactjs
、
eslint
我
正在使用
react
16.8
和
eslint - .When -
react
-
hooks
1.6.0插件,
我
有条件地使用钩子,
我
希望eslint会警告
我
。"rules": { "
react
-
ho
浏览 0
提问于2019-04-28
得票数 15
1
回答
如何
在FlatList中使用callBack()钩子?
javascript
、
reactjs
、
react-native
、
react-hooks
我
正在尝试提高
我
的应用程序的性能,所以我使用FC来渲染项目, 但这对
我
来说不是很好!当我向下滚动时I ++page
在
useEffect()
中
,
我
发送了一个请求,以获取基于页面的新数据,并在UI
中
很好地呈现项目!“加载更多功能”。但是,当我
在
点击项目之前记录整个“歌曲”
数组
时,
我
只得到了前两页!有时我会得到一个空
数组
。 那么,
我
的代码
中
到底出了什么问题呢?] =
浏览 14
提问于2020-04-06
得票数 0
回答已采纳
4
回答
查找
反转
数组
的原始索引
javascript
、
arrays
、
json
、
reverse
我
使用reverse() javascript函数来
反转
保存在本地存储
数组
中
的对象。但我正在尝试将原始索引与新排序的
数组
结合起来。
我
的实际情况有点复杂,因为原始字符串是JSON格式的: var data = {"info":[{"name":"Max"},{"name":"Alex},{"name":"Sam"},{"name":"
浏览 0
提问于2016-11-11
得票数 2
1
回答
当NPM链接一个
React
包时,重复的
React
实例。无效钩子调用
javascript
、
reactjs
、
npm
、
dependencies
、
npm-scripts
我
目前正在建立一个反应设计系统库。
我
正在使用Rollup.js作为邦德勒。由于我的dist文件夹位于package.json
中
的files密钥
中
,
浏览 3
提问于2021-07-01
得票数 4
2
回答
如何
正确使用钩子?
javascript
、
reactjs
、
react-native
、
react-hooks
我
有一些问题 1-
我
定义了一个从API获取数据并在useEffect
中
调用它的函数,
它
运行良好,但我
在
VScode
中
得到了这个警告。
React
React
.useEffect缺少一个依赖项:'getOpenOrders‘。要么包含
它
,要么删除依赖
数组
。2-
我
在
FlatList
中
实现分页,因此当用户到达数据列表的末尾时,
我
调用一个函数来增
浏览 3
提问于2020-09-03
得票数 1
3
回答
eslint vscode插件没有为钩子生成警告。
reactjs
、
visual-studio-code
、
create-react-app
、
eslint
我
用npx create-
react
-app my-app创建了一个
react
应用程序,并进行了纱线安装。
在
App.js
中
添加了以下内容: b = () => 2, const wut = useMemo
我
添加了具有以下内容的.eslintrc.js: env: { es6
浏览 1
提问于2019-09-14
得票数 3
回答已采纳
7
回答
React
:给定一个
数组
,以逆序高效地呈现元素
javascript
、
reactjs
我
目前以典型的
React
风格呈现一个列表。该列表是作为
数组
属性传递的,我像这样映射
它
:因此,当添加新元素时,
它
看起来就像是将最新的项目添加到了列表的末尾
我
想要
它
,这样最新的商品就会出现在顶部。也就是说,所有的东西都是按时间倒序出现的。 到目前为止,
我
想出的两个选择是: 1)
反转
列表,每次添加内容时创建一个新的
数组
,并将这个<
浏览 2
提问于2016-06-07
得票数 13
1
回答
react
钩子背后的JavaScript机制是
如何
工作的?
javascript
、
reactjs
、
react-hooks
我
的问题与使
react
挂钩成为可能的Javascript机制有关。
React
的最新发展让我们可以创建钩子,即。,我们
在
应用程序函数
中
通过
数组
分解来使用它们。
我
的问题是钩子机制
在
JS
中
是
如何
工作的? 从
我
在
React
sourcecode中看到的,
它
使用了reducer函数
和
流的类型检查。对于我来说,代码很难理解大局。这个问题不
浏览 19
提问于2018-12-22
得票数 14
回答已采纳
3
回答
为什么会产生无限循环?
javascript
、
reactjs
、
react-hooks
、
use-effect
、
react-functional-component
我
正在尝试使用
React
钩子在数据上创建一个过滤器。
我
真的不明白为什么这段代码会在
我
调用setEnteredFilter时创建一个无限循环。LoadedData是一个包含一些对象的
数组
,
我
只需要id与我
在
搜索栏
中
输入的内容相匹配的对象。
浏览 28
提问于2021-02-10
得票数 0
回答已采纳
2
回答
避免向useEffect添加不必要的依赖项
javascript
、
reactjs
、
redux
、
react-redux
、
eslint
我
在
我
的应用程序中使用了
react
表,服务器端用搜索分页。每当分页更改时,
我
都会使用onPaginationChange支持来调用API。但我也有一个搜索输入文本。API calls );}, [searchText]); 在这里,Eslint抱怨我需要将currentPage添加到依赖
数组
中
但是,如果
我
添加
它
,并且由于某些分页更改而调用onPaginati
浏览 2
提问于2022-06-02
得票数 5
3
回答
更新
数组
内的状态最好的方法是什么
javascript
、
reactjs
、
react-redux
我
有一个遍历所有订单的代码,并将is_confirmed属性更新为1。问题是
我
必须遍历所有订单,找到与订单id匹配的订单并更新
它
。
我
的问题是,有没有更有效的方法来做到这一点,而不是遍历所有的对象?
浏览 43
提问于2021-01-12
得票数 2
点击加载更多
扫码
添加站长 进交流群
领取专属
10元无门槛券
手把手带您无忧上云
相关
资讯
React Hooks源码深度解析
我用React和Vue构建了同款应用,对比看看
我用React和Vue构建了同款应用,来看看哪里不一样(2020版)
React Hooks踩坑分享
我读完了React的API,并为新手送上了一些建议
热门
标签
更多标签
活动推荐
运营活动
广告
关闭
领券